Okay we have some serious problem here with starting the Routing and Remote acces service on Windows 2008 SBS server,

It all started with a corrupt patch from Eset NOD32 which was installed on our server. After the corrupt patch a lot of problems started with the LAN interface. after we removed Eset NOD32 all things started to look ok again except the Routing and Remote Access didn't start.

We got the error message "Unable to load c:\Windows\System32\iprtrmgr.dll" and event 201013 and 7024 ( The Routing and Remote Access service terminated with service-specific error 31 (0x1F) ).



After going through internet we found differtent solutions which sadly didn't work

we tried;



Removing the Role Routing and Remote access and reinstalling it.

Resetting the tcp ip ( netsh int reset )

Removing the registry ( H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Services\RemoteAccess \RouterManagers\Ipv6 )

Removed phantom adapters (there were none) by using the following tip:

1 Run the command "set devmgr_show_nonpresent_devices=1"to see all the phantom devices.
2. Opened Device Manager (Start - Run - devmgmt.msc) and select "View" menu and choose "Show Hidden Devices".
3. Expand Network Adapters and look for any non-existing network adapters.
4. Uninstall all the phantom adaptors except RAS Async adapter, WAN Miniport adapters, Microsoft ISATAP Adapter and Microsoft Virtual Machine Bus

Renamed the ias.xlm and dynary.xml in c:\windows\system32\ias

Copied the file iprtmgr.dll from another SBS 2008 computer.

in the router.log (c:\windows\tracing\ we find:



Error 31 occured during the router manager C initialization.
RTRMGR is unloaded from DIM
ServiceMain: Error 31 occured while loading router managers.
DimUnloadRouterManagers: fAllRouterManagersStopped

All the above solutions didn't work for us...the Routing and Remote access service still doesn't start.
